Titleist T250 Iron Review: A Swing for Success

Hey there, golf enthusiasts! If you’ve been on the hunt for a new iron that’s both stylish and packed with features, you’re in for a treat. Today, let’s dive into the Titleist T250 Iron, the latest addition to the T-Series. This model promises to deliver more distance without sacrificing that classic look we all love. So, let’s jump right in and see if it lives up to the hype!

A Quick Overview of the T-Series

Titleist has built an impressive legacy with its T-Series irons over the years. The T250 stands out as the new kid on the block in 2025, alongside its familiar siblings—the T100 and T150. Tech That Takes Your Game Up a Notch

What makes the T250 Iron tick? Titleist’s innovative design philosophy comes into play here. Made with a high-strength steel for the face and body, the T250 is crafted to house performance-enhancing technology effectively. They’ve included a new forged L-Face with a V-taper design to boost ball speed across the face. This feature is particularly beneficial for low-face strikes—an area where many golfers tend to struggle.

Consistency Is Key

One of the highlights of the T250 is its consistency. Improved Max Impact Technology aims to deliver more predictable carry distances and tighter dispersion. What’s that mean? In simple terms, you’ll hit the ball further with more accuracy, even if you don’t perfectly strike the sweet spot. Plus, the mid/short-iron grooves are designed to maximize spin control—something that any golfer would appreciate, especially for those tricky lies.

First Impressions Matter: A Visual Stunner

Let’s face it: Looks are important when selecting golf equipment, and the T250 does not disappoint. Its clean, modern design stands out in the bag, setting the bar high for competitors. Although it has a slightly larger profile than the T100, it hardly feels clunky. Instead, it’s confidence-inspiring with a subtle thickness in the top line and a bit of offset, making it easy to address the ball.

Performance That Speaks for Itself

So, how does the T250 actually perform? Spoiler alert: it checks all the right boxes. The stronger lofts—like the 30.5˚ loft on the 7-iron—coupled with ideal internal weighting give the T250 its signature punch. Expect remarkable ball speeds and explosive distances without the unpredictability that can often come with distance-focused models. You can rely on this iron to deliver consistently great results.

Feel Like a Pro

A solid feel when striking the ball is essential for any golfer, and here’s where the T250 shines. While it’s slightly livelier than the T100 and T150, the feedback you get when making contact provides a solid sense of where your shot is heading. You can really feel how you’ve hit the ball, which adds to the overall confidence on the course.

Forgiveness in Spades

Golfers, rejoice! If you’re worried about missing the sweet spot, the T250 has got your back. The dispersion from the front to back was impressive during my testing. Even if you mishit, you won’t lose much ball speed—meaning you can still achieve great distances. This feature makes it a perfect choice for players looking to improve their game without feeling penalized for less-than-perfect strikes.

Tailored to Individual Needs

Here’s something unique: the T250 irons are available in a special ‘Launch Spec.’ This version is tailored for players with moderate swing speeds or those who struggle to get the ball airborne. By reducing the head weight and adding some extra loft, Titleist ensures that more golfers can enjoy the T250’s outstanding performance.

Ready to Hit the Market

With the T250 hitting retail shops soon, it’s hard to imagine a better choice for those looking to enhance their distance without compromising on style. The pricing—for both steel and graphite sets—ranges from $1499 to $1599, making it a reasonable investment for those serious about improving their game.
